![]() ![]() John is too wrapped up in his own crippling pain and misery to even acknowledge Michael, while the young gardener only sees that John’s selfishness makes his servants’ lives difficult. When Michael is blackmailed into taking a job as a gardener on the estate, their paths cross. Once a promising young medical student, Michael now does massages-and more-in a Bowery bathhouse, while John lives the life of a recluse in his family’s country mansion. ![]() Scion of Hudson Valley aristocrats John Seward and the son of poor Irish immigrants Michael McCready have only one thing in common-they have both been broken by the First World War, John in body, Michael in spirit. ![]()
